| // This class is for holding a DBusMethodResponse in a std::shared_ptr, so that |
| // we can bind it to two separate callback. |
| template <typename... Types> |
| class SharedDBusMethodResponse { |
| public: |
| explicit SharedDBusMethodResponse( |
| std::unique_ptr<brillo::dbus_utils::DBusMethodResponse<Types...>> |
| response) |
| : response_(std::move(response)) {} |
| |
| void ReplyWithError(const brillo::Error* error) { |
| CHECK(response_) << "ReplyWithError() called after response has been sent"; |
| response_->ReplyWithError(error); |
| response_.reset(nullptr); |
| } |
| |
| void ReplyWithError(const base::Location& location, |
| const std::string& error_domain, |
| const std::string& error_code, |
| const std::string& error_message) { |
| CHECK(response_) << "ReplyWithError() (4 parameter version) called after " |
| "response has been sent"; |
| response_->ReplyWithError(location, error_domain, error_code, |
| error_message); |
| response_.reset(nullptr); |
| } |
| |
| void Return(const Types&... return_values) { |
| CHECK(response_) << "Return() called after response has been sent"; |
| response_->Return(return_values...); |
| response_.reset(nullptr); |
| } |
| |
| private: |
| std::unique_ptr<brillo::dbus_utils::DBusMethodResponse<Types...>> response_; |
| }; |

| // This serves as the on_failure callback after calling the actual method |
| // in attestationd. |
| // Note that this is for the version of async call that have data result. |
| template <typename ReplyProtoType> |
| void AsyncForwardErrorWithData(const std::string& (ReplyProtoType::*func)() |
| const, |
| int async_id, |
| brillo::Error* err) { |
| // Error is ignored because there is no mechanism to forward the dbus |
| // error through signal, and the current implementation in |
| // service_distributed class handles the error by sending |
| // STATUS_NOT_AVAILABLE instead, so we follow this behaviour. |
| ReplyProtoType reply; |
| reply.set_status(attestation::AttestationStatus::STATUS_NOT_AVAILABLE); |
| AsyncReplyWithData(func, async_id, reply); |
| } |
| |
| // This serves as the on_failure callback after calling the actual method |
| // in attestationd |
| // Note that this is for the version of async call that have no data result. |
| template <typename ReplyProtoType> |
| void AsyncForwardErrorWithNoData(int async_id, brillo::Error* err) { |
| // Error is ignored because there is no mechanism to forward the dbus |
| // error through signal, and the current implementation in |
| // service_distributed class handles the error by sending |
| // STATUS_NOT_AVAILABLE instead, so we follow this behaviour. |
| ReplyProtoType reply; |
| reply.set_status(attestation::AttestationStatus::STATUS_NOT_AVAILABLE); |
| AsyncReplyWithNoData(async_id, reply); |
| } |
| |
| // This serves as the on_success callback for async methods with data after |
| // calling the actual method in attestationd. |
| template <typename ReplyProtoType> |
| void AsyncReplyWithData(const std::string& (ReplyProtoType::*func)() const, |
| int async_id, |
| const ReplyProtoType& reply) { |
| std::string data_string = (reply.*func)(); |
| std::vector<uint8_t> data(data_string.begin(), data_string.end()); |
| bool return_status = |
| reply.status() == attestation::AttestationStatus::STATUS_SUCCESS; |
| VirtualSendAsyncCallStatusWithDataSignal(async_id, return_status, data); |
| } |
| |
| // This serves as the on_success callback for async methods with no data after |
| // calling the actual method in attestationd. |
| template <typename ReplyProtoType> |
| void AsyncReplyWithNoData(int async_id, const ReplyProtoType& reply) { |
| bool return_status = |
| reply.status() == attestation::AttestationStatus::STATUS_SUCCESS; |
| VirtualSendAsyncCallStatusSignal(async_id, return_status, 0); |
| } |
| |
| // This is a function that handles an async request received on the legacy |
| // cryptohome interface. The code that calls this function resides in |
| // the actual method handler, and it only needs to assemble the request |
| // proto and pass it to this function, and this function will take care |
| // of the rest. |
| // Note that this version deals with async method calls that return byte array |
| // data. |
| template <typename RequestProtoType, typename ReplyProtoType> |
| int HandleAsyncData(const std::string& (ReplyProtoType::*func)() const, |
| RequestProtoType request, |
| base::OnceCallback<void( |
| const RequestProtoType&, |
| const base::Callback<void(const ReplyProtoType&)>&, |
| const base::Callback<void(brillo::Error*)>&, |
| int)> target_method, |
| int timeout_ms = dbus::ObjectProxy::TIMEOUT_USE_DEFAULT) { |
| int async_id = NextSequence(); |
| |
| base::Callback<void(const ReplyProtoType&)> on_success = base::Bind( |
| &LegacyCryptohomeInterfaceAdaptor::AsyncReplyWithData<ReplyProtoType>, |
| base::Unretained(this), func, async_id); |
| base::Callback<void(brillo::Error*)> on_failure = |
| base::Bind(&LegacyCryptohomeInterfaceAdaptor::AsyncForwardErrorWithData< |
| ReplyProtoType>, |
| base::Unretained(this), func, async_id); |
| std::move(target_method).Run(request, on_success, on_failure, timeout_ms); |
| |
| return async_id; |
| } |
| |
| // This is a function that handles an async request received on the legacy |
| // cryptohome interface. The code that calls this function resides in |
| // the actual method handler, and it only needs to assemble the request |
| // proto and pass it to this function, and this function will take care |
| // of the rest. |
| // Note that this version deals with async method calls that return only |
| // status but not data. |
| template <typename RequestProtoType, typename ReplyProtoType> |
| int HandleAsyncStatus(RequestProtoType request, |
| base::OnceCallback<void( |
| const RequestProtoType&, |
| const base::Callback<void(const ReplyProtoType&)>&, |
| const base::Callback<void(brillo::Error*)>&, |
| int)> target_method) { |
| int async_id = NextSequence(); |
| |
| base::Callback<void(const ReplyProtoType&)> on_success = base::Bind( |
| &LegacyCryptohomeInterfaceAdaptor::AsyncReplyWithNoData<ReplyProtoType>, |
| base::Unretained(this), async_id); |
| base::Callback<void(brillo::Error*)> on_failure = base::Bind( |
| &LegacyCryptohomeInterfaceAdaptor::AsyncForwardErrorWithNoData< |
| ReplyProtoType>, |
| base::Unretained(this), async_id); |
| std::move(target_method) |
| .Run(request, on_success, on_failure, |
| dbus::ObjectProxy::TIMEOUT_USE_DEFAULT); |
| |
| return async_id; |
| } |
| |
| // This method is used when the handler for a successful DBus call to the new |
| // API only needs to forward the error code in the new API's proto to a |
| // BaseReply type on the legacy API. |
| template <typename ReplyProtoType> |
| static void ForwardBaseReplyErrorCode( |
| std::shared_ptr<SharedDBusMethodResponse<cryptohome::BaseReply>> response, |
| const ReplyProtoType& reply) { |
| cryptohome::BaseReply base_reply; |
| base_reply.set_error( |
| static_cast<cryptohome::CryptohomeErrorCode>(reply.error())); |
| ClearErrorIfNotSet(&base_reply); |
| response->Return(base_reply); |
| } |
